Title; Associated Form; and OMB Number: AARO Contact Form for Authorized Reporting; OMB Control Number: 0704-0674.
Type of Request: Extension.
Number of Respondents: 2,500.
Responses per Respondent: 1.
Annual Responses: 2,500.
Average Burden per Response: 5 minutes.
Annual Burden Hours: 208.
Needs and Uses: The All-domain Anomaly Resolution Office ( AARO ) Contact Form for Authorized Reporting information collection will be used to gather contact information, to include Personally Identifiable Information (PII), from members of the public. The collection is necessary to enable the AARO, Office of the Secretary of Defense, Department of Defense, to meet its statutory requirements.
The proposed information collection, AARO Contact Form for Authorized Reporting, enables AARO to comply with Section 1673 of the James M. Inhofe National Defense Authorization Act for Fiscal Year 2023 (FY23 NDAA), which directs AARO to establish a secure mechanism for authorized reporting of U.S. Government programs and activities related unidentified anomalous phenomena (UAP). The form will collect contact information from current and former U.S. Government employees, service members, and contractors who wish to make an authorized report to AARO. The collection is necessary to enable persons wanting to make a report to contact AARO directly.

The respondents are current and former U.S. Government employees, service members, and contractors who want to contact AARO in furtherance of providing authorized reporting regarding potential U.S. Governments activities and events related to UAP. The respondents will be asked to voluntarily provide their contact information by completing fields and using drop down menus on a page within AARO's website ( www.aaro.mil ). This form is the only collection instrument, is 100 percent electronic, and is accessible by any web browser, via both desktop and mobile device. The collection is sent to AARO once the respondent clicks the "Submit" button on the website. No other communications are sent to the respondents that solicit responses. The Office of the Secretary of Defense Public Affairs will notify the public when AARO's contact form is available for use.
Information, including PII, collected from the public will be processed and stored in an electronic environment accredited to handle and secure PII. AARO will then review submitted information to prioritize potential oral history interviews of persons so that they might make an authorized report. The end result of the information collection is the successful ability of individuals to contact AARO, provide a report, and contribute to the HRR, and for AARO to meet its statutory requirements.
